WORLD IN BRIEF : MEXICO : Ruling Party Sweeps Nuevo Leon Voting

From Times Staff and Wire Reports
Mexico’s ruling party, flexing its muscle ahead of midterm elections in August, scored a crushing victory in recent elections for governor and state deputies in the northern industrial state of Nuevo Leon, authorities said. Socrates Rizzo, gubernatorial candidate of the ruling Institutional Revolutionary Party (PRI), won 60% of the vote in Sunday’s race, and the PRI took 25 of 26 deputy seats. The conservative National Action Party won 31.5% of the gubernatorial vote and one deputy seat.
